6 февраля приглашаем на Зимнюю ярмарку вакансий, которая пройдёт офлайн и онлайн. Это классная возможность стать частью IT-сообщества Яндекса и познакомиться с теми, кто создаёт сервисы с многомиллионной аудиторией.
Что вас ждёт
Узнаете о новых вакансиях и задачах, а также сможете лично пообщаться с командами и подать заявку туда, где понравится больше всего.
Узнаете о технологиях и кейсах из практики экспертов Яндекса. Лекции пройдут по основным направлениям стажировки: бэкенд, фронтенд, мобильная разработка, аналитика и машинное обучение.
Узнаете, как они проходили отбор, как готовились и чем планируют заниматься дальше. Сейчас в Яндексе стажируются более 600 человек — им есть что рассказать.
Как принять участие
Чтобы попасть на ярмарку, нужно пройти предварительный отбор — решить задачи на Яндекс Контесте до 31 января включительно. Тех, кто решит все задачи из Контеста, мы пригласим на вечернее закрытое шоу «Все в плюсе».
Узнать подробности и подать заявку: [ клик! ]
#ЗимняяЯрмаркаВакансий
Please open Telegram to view this post
VIEW IN TELEGRAM
Развертывание MLFlow в AWS с помощью Terraform
Оптимизируйте рабочие процессы машинного обучения: простое руководство по развертыванию MLFlow на AWS https://mmeendez8.github.io/2023/11/22/deploy-mlflow-terraform.html
Оптимизируйте рабочие процессы машинного обучения: простое руководство по развертыванию MLFlow на AWS https://mmeendez8.github.io/2023/11/22/deploy-mlflow-terraform.html
Miguel-Mendez-Ai
Deploying MLFlow in AWS with Terraform
Explore this step-by-step guide on deploying MLFlow in AWS using Terraform. Learn how to effectively manage your machine learning lifecycle, set up a Postgres database, create a secure S3 bucket, and customize a MLFlow Docker image. Improve you Machine Learning…
10 самых распространенных проблем при линтинге Dockerfile'ов
Весной 2023 года разработчики Depot добавили в свой сервис возможность проверять Dockerfile'ы при каждой сборке.
В этой статье они делятся десятью наиболее распространенными проблемами при линтинге Dockerfile'ов, разбирают каждую проблему и объясняют, почему она возникает и как ее решить. Авторы отмечают, что со временем список может измениться, но даже в таком виде он станет хорошей отправной точкой для оптимизации Dockerfile'ов. https://habr.com/ru/companies/flant/articles/787494/
Весной 2023 года разработчики Depot добавили в свой сервис возможность проверять Dockerfile'ы при каждой сборке.
В этой статье они делятся десятью наиболее распространенными проблемами при линтинге Dockerfile'ов, разбирают каждую проблему и объясняют, почему она возникает и как ее решить. Авторы отмечают, что со временем список может измениться, но даже в таком виде он станет хорошей отправной точкой для оптимизации Dockerfile'ов. https://habr.com/ru/companies/flant/articles/787494/
Хабр
10 самых распространенных проблем при линтинге Dockerfile'ов
Весной 2023 года разработчики Depot сообщили о том, что теперь с помощью их сервиса можно проверять Dockerfile при каждой сборке. Depot — это сервис удаленной сборки контейнеров, который может...
This media is not supported in your browser
VIEW IN TELEGRAM
Расширенный комплексный трехуровневый проект DevSecOps Kubernetes с использованием AWS EKS, ArgoCD, Prometheus, Grafana и Jenkins
https://blog.stackademic.com/advanced-end-to-end-devsecops-kubernetes-three-tier-project-using-aws-eks-argocd-prometheus-fbbfdb956d1a
https://blog.stackademic.com/advanced-end-to-end-devsecops-kubernetes-three-tier-project-using-aws-eks-argocd-prometheus-fbbfdb956d1a
Forwarded from KazDevOps
Разыгрываем 10 ваучеров на бесплатное обучение и сертификацию от The Linux Foundation. Ваучеры дают 100% скидку на курс или экзамен из списка ниже до 17.01.2025 — и мы хотим ими поделиться:
Их можно применить к любому:
— онлайн-курсу
— сертификационному экзамену
— или пакету (курс + сертификация)
🤝 CKA, CKS, CKAD и другие — в комплекте!
Условия розыгрыша просты:
Go-go-go, и успехов!
#kubernetes #cka #ckad #cks #k8s #linuxfoundation #cncf
@DevOpsKaz
Please open Telegram to view this post
VIEW IN TELEGRAM
Внутри Git (5 минут чтения)
В этой статье рассматриваются различные объекты git, хранящиеся в файловой системе. Эту статью стоит прочитать, если вам когда-нибудь было интересно узнать о внутреннем устройстве git!
https://jvns.ca/blog/2024/01/26/inside-git
В этой статье рассматриваются различные объекты git, хранящиеся в файловой системе. Эту статью стоит прочитать, если вам когда-нибудь было интересно узнать о внутреннем устройстве git!
https://jvns.ca/blog/2024/01/26/inside-git
Julia Evans
Inside .git
Hello! I posted a comic on Mastodon this week about what’s in the .git directory and someone requested a text version, so here it is. I added some extra notes too. First, here’s the image. It’s a ~15 word explanation of each part of your .git directory.
Типичные проблемы, с которыми сталкиваются при настройке CI/CD для Terraform в большом масштабе
https://dev.to/digger/typical-challenges-faced-while-setting-up-cicd-for-terraform-at-scale-37hn
https://dev.to/digger/typical-challenges-faced-while-setting-up-cicd-for-terraform-at-scale-37hn
DEV Community
Typical challenges faced while setting up CI/CD for Terraform at scale
Say, hypothetically, that you are a part of a startup handling payments, and after a good few months...
Как мы управляем инфраструктурой на более 1000 серверов при помощи Ansible
У нас за плечами больше 15 лет опыта, в том числе поддержка сервисов Rapida, CyberPlat, TeleTrade, сопровождение стека BigData и внедрение кластеров Hadoop. В этой статье мы расскажем, как выбирали систему управления конфигурациями, какими критериями руководствовались, что в итоге выбрали, с какими проблемами столкнулись и как их решали.
Рассматривать вопрос, зачем вообще нужна система управления конфигурацией, не будем. Потому что считаем, что если у вас больше одного сервера, она уже необходима. Перейдём сразу к тому, почему мы выбрали именно Ansible. https://habr.com/ru/companies/oleg-bunin/articles/788552/
У нас за плечами больше 15 лет опыта, в том числе поддержка сервисов Rapida, CyberPlat, TeleTrade, сопровождение стека BigData и внедрение кластеров Hadoop. В этой статье мы расскажем, как выбирали систему управления конфигурациями, какими критериями руководствовались, что в итоге выбрали, с какими проблемами столкнулись и как их решали.
Рассматривать вопрос, зачем вообще нужна система управления конфигурацией, не будем. Потому что считаем, что если у вас больше одного сервера, она уже необходима. Перейдём сразу к тому, почему мы выбрали именно Ansible. https://habr.com/ru/companies/oleg-bunin/articles/788552/
Хабр
Как мы управляем инфраструктурой на более 1000 серверов при помощи Ansible
Привет, Хабр! Мы системные инженеры X5 Tech — Алексей Кузнецов и Борис Мурашин . У нас за плечами больше 15 лет опыта, в том числе поддержка сервисов Rapida, CyberPlat, TeleTrade, сопровождение стека...
Forwarded from Cloud Services
Kubernetes для ленивых разработчиков
https://www.marcobehler.com/guides/kubernetes-for-lazy-developers
https://www.marcobehler.com/guides/kubernetes-for-lazy-developers
Marcobehler
What is Kubernetes? An Unorthodox Guide for Developers
You can use this guide to get up to speed with Kubernetes as a developer. From its very basics to more intermediate topics like Helm charts and how all of this affects you as a dev.
Как создать полнофункциональную платформу Kubernetes для запуска микросервисов
Я пишу серию статей, в которых объясняется, как создать полнофункциональную платформу Kubernetes. Цель — создать кластер со всеми функциями, необходимыми для работы и обслуживания микросервисов. В этой статье я объединяю все это, ссылаясь на статьи в том порядке, в котором им следует следовать для создания платформы. https://medium.com/@martin.hodges/how-to-create-a-full-featured-kubernetes-platform-for-running-micro-services-c145ab71a2eb
Я пишу серию статей, в которых объясняется, как создать полнофункциональную платформу Kubernetes. Цель — создать кластер со всеми функциями, необходимыми для работы и обслуживания микросервисов. В этой статье я объединяю все это, ссылаясь на статьи в том порядке, в котором им следует следовать для создания платформы. https://medium.com/@martin.hodges/how-to-create-a-full-featured-kubernetes-platform-for-running-micro-services-c145ab71a2eb
Medium
How to create a full-featured Kubernetes platform for running micro-services
I have been writing a series of articles that explain how to create a full-featured Kubernetes platform. The aim is to create a cluster…
Расширенный комплексный проект DevOps: развертывание приложения микросервисов в AWS EKS с использованием Terraform, Helm, Jenkins и ArgoCD (часть I)
https://dev.to/kelvinskell/advanced-end-to-end-devops-project-deploying-a-microservices-app-to-aws-eks-using-terraform-helm-jenkins-and-argocd-part-i-3a53
https://dev.to/kelvinskell/advanced-end-to-end-devops-project-deploying-a-microservices-app-to-aws-eks-using-terraform-helm-jenkins-and-argocd-part-i-3a53
DEV Community
Advanced End-to-End DevOps Project: Deploying A Microservices APP To AWS EKS
This post was originally publised at Practical Cloud DevOps is a rapidly evolving space in the IT...
Forwarded from Cloud Services
Виртуализация и контейнеризация: что выбрать?
https://blog.bytebytego.com/p/virtualization-and-containerization
https://blog.bytebytego.com/p/virtualization-and-containerization
Bytebytego
Virtualization and Containerization: Which one to pick?
Software applications have traditionally been closely tied to the specific servers they run on and the operating systems they use. But as companies look to get more out of their infrastructure while spending less time and effort managing it, vendors are offering…
Forwarded from Daily Dev Jokes. Юмор.
This media is not supported in your browser
VIEW IN TELEGRAM
Я и моя команда DevOps пытаемся устранить неполадки кластера Kubernetes в рабочей среде
Автоматизируем сборку и деплой приложения в GitLab CI/CD: подробное руководство с примерами
При разработке приложений рано или поздно наступает момент, когда заниматься развёртыванием вручную становится затратно и неудобно. Как следствие на помощь приходит автоматизация этого процесса с помощью специально настроенных пайплайнов непрерывной интеграции и непрерывной доставки (Continuous Integration Continuous Delivery — CI/CD). Для разных систем управления репозиториями исходного кода существуют свои способы настройки CI/CD.
В этой статье мы рассмотрим, как использовать GitLab для организации автоматической сборки и деплоя приложения в кластер Kubernetes.
https://habr.com/ru/articles/795475/
При разработке приложений рано или поздно наступает момент, когда заниматься развёртыванием вручную становится затратно и неудобно. Как следствие на помощь приходит автоматизация этого процесса с помощью специально настроенных пайплайнов непрерывной интеграции и непрерывной доставки (Continuous Integration Continuous Delivery — CI/CD). Для разных систем управления репозиториями исходного кода существуют свои способы настройки CI/CD.
В этой статье мы рассмотрим, как использовать GitLab для организации автоматической сборки и деплоя приложения в кластер Kubernetes.
https://habr.com/ru/articles/795475/
Хабр
Автоматизируем сборку и деплой приложения в GitLab CI/CD: подробное руководство с примерами
При разработке приложений рано или поздно наступает момент, когда заниматься развёртыванием вручную становится затратно и неудобно. Как следствие на помощь приходит автоматизация этого процесса с...
Контейнеры разработчика: минимизация зависимостей локального компьютера с помощью воспроизводимых настроек.
Представьте себе возможность мгновенно воссоздать всю настройку разработки — независимо от того, где вы находитесь! Вот что привносят в игру Devcontainers.
https://medium.com/@seifeddinerajhi/devcontainers-minimizing-local-machine-dependencies-with-replicable-setups-f482882f095b
Zarf: инструмент развертывания с открытым исходным кодом, который вам нужен 💠
https://medium.com/@seifeddinerajhi/zarf-the-open-source-deployment-tool-you-need-199fc791366e
Представьте себе возможность мгновенно воссоздать всю настройку разработки — независимо от того, где вы находитесь! Вот что привносят в игру Devcontainers.
https://medium.com/@seifeddinerajhi/devcontainers-minimizing-local-machine-dependencies-with-replicable-setups-f482882f095b
Zarf: инструмент развертывания с открытым исходным кодом, который вам нужен 💠
https://medium.com/@seifeddinerajhi/zarf-the-open-source-deployment-tool-you-need-199fc791366e
Medium
Devcontainers: Minimizing local machine dependencies with replicable Setups
Building consistency in distributed teams 🐳
Использование docker init для написания Dockerfile и docker-compose конфигураций
https://medium.com/@akhilesh-mishra/you-should-stop-writing-dockerfiles-today-do-this-instead-3cd8a44cb8b0
https://medium.com/@akhilesh-mishra/you-should-stop-writing-dockerfiles-today-do-this-instead-3cd8a44cb8b0
Medium
You should stop writing Dockerfiles today — Do this instead
Using docker init to write Dockerfile and docker-compose configs
Nemo: инструмент мониторинга Kubernetes
Nemo — это инструмент мониторинга Kubernetes, который упрощает управление кластером, предоставляет подробные метрики на уровнях узлов и модулей, а также предлагает расширенные функции для будущих улучшений. https://medium.com/@akbenkov79/nemo-a-kubernetes-monitoring-tool-8c97d2d283a4
Nemo — это инструмент мониторинга Kubernetes, который упрощает управление кластером, предоставляет подробные метрики на уровнях узлов и модулей, а также предлагает расширенные функции для будущих улучшений. https://medium.com/@akbenkov79/nemo-a-kubernetes-monitoring-tool-8c97d2d283a4
Medium
Nemo: A Kubernetes Monitoring Tool
Co-authored by Ari Benkov, Paul Burger, Trevor Hilz, Anthony Chaiditya, and Callum Miles
Docker и Docker Compose — это мощные инструменты, используемые в современных рабочих процессах разработки и развертывания программного обеспечения. Docker позволяет разработчикам упаковывать приложения и их зависимости в легкие контейнеры, а Docker Compose упрощает управление многоконтейнерными приложениями.
https://www.javacodegeeks.com/2024/03/docker-and-docker-compose.html
https://www.javacodegeeks.com/2024/03/docker-and-docker-compose.html
Java Code Geeks
Docker and Docker compose - Java Code Geeks
Docker and Docker compose: Isolate environments and scale effortlessly with Docker and Docker Compose for seamless deployment.
Расширенная маршрутизация запросов с помощью ALB . Узнайте, как использовать расширенную маршрутизацию запросов Application Load Balancer для эффективной маршрутизации трафика приложений между несколькими кластерами Amazon EKS.
Terraform как услуга с Google : погрузитесь в управление инфраструктурой Google с помощью Terraform как услуги.
Автоматизация инфраструктуры . Узнайте, как создать инфраструктуру с помощью шаблонов Backstage, Terraform и действий GitHub для оптимизации операций.
Запуск Selenium на стероидах : пошаговое руководство по настройке сервера Selenium на AWS Lambda.
Terraform как услуга с Google : погрузитесь в управление инфраструктурой Google с помощью Terraform как услуги.
Автоматизация инфраструктуры . Узнайте, как создать инфраструктуру с помощью шаблонов Backstage, Terraform и действий GitHub для оптимизации операций.
Запуск Selenium на стероидах : пошаговое руководство по настройке сервера Selenium на AWS Lambda.
Amazon
How to leverage Application Load Balancer’s advanced request routing to route application traffic across multiple Amazon EKS clusters…
Introduction The AWS Load Balancer Controller is a Kubernetes Special Interest Group (SIG) project, which enables organizations reduce their Kubernetes compute costs and the complexity of their application routing configuration. As you deploy workloads on…